The Evolution of Generative Ai Tools: Gemini 3.7 Flash Arrives
Google is moving faster than ever. It has released Gemini 3.7 Flash just three weeks after 3.6 Flash. This new model is built to be the ultimate workhorse for coding and agent workflows.
According to the official Google announcement, developer efficiency has skyrocketed. First-pass coding accuracy rose from 34.4% to 43.6% on the FrontierCode benchmark.
Performance on DeepSWE jumped from 49.0% to 65.3%. This massive improvement means developers spend less time cleaning up messy code.
Furthermore, the model builds functional web pages and apps with fewer prompts. It matches design references with high accuracy. It also parses dense files, like financial contracts, with ease.
To make it more appealing, Google slashed the price in half. Through the end of the year, input tokens cost $0.75 per million. Output tokens cost $3.75 per million.
The model already powers Spark, Google’s 24/7 personal AI agent. Developers can access it via Google AI Studio, Android Studio, or Google Antigravity. OpenAI and Microsoft Reshape the User Experience
OpenAI is also pushing boundaries with ChatGPT. The platform can now remember your activity from yesterday.
Its new “Computer History” feature turns your computer activity into active context. This allows ChatGPT to give highly relevant and tailored answers.
Users can even reference previously completed tasks. ChatGPT can then turn those workflows into repeatable, automated skills. This feature represents a massive leap for customized productivity.

At the same time, OpenAI rolled out “Ultrafast” mode for GPT-5.6 Sol. This mode operates at an astonishing 14x its normal speed. Currently, it is available to a limited group of companies.
Meanwhile, Microsoft is taking a very different approach. The tech giant is stripping features from Copilot. It is merging its consumer and business apps into a single tool.
In the process, Microsoft is eliminating several features. These include Group Chats, Podcasts, Deep Research, Copilot Labs, and Mico. Mico was the Clippy-like mascot announced last October.
This aggressive redesign aims to create a cleaner foundation. It sets the stage for an upcoming “super app” expected by late September.

Booming Demand Sparks AI Infrastructure Recovery

The financial markets are reflecting this intense AI demand. AI infrastructure stocks have fully recovered from June’s losses. Strong earnings reports and upbeat revenue projections fueled the rally.
Industry giants like CoreWeave, SMCI, and Nebius reported massive growth. Nebius stood out with a spectacular week. Its stock rose roughly 40% after revealing Q2 revenue.
The company reported $582 million in Q2 revenue. This represents an incredible 450% year-over-year jump. This financial boom proves that the hunger for AI compute capacity is still growing.

Embodied AI and the Future of Smart Devices
AI is quickly moving out of the cloud and into the physical world. Honor’s highly anticipated Robot Phone has officially launched in China. This unique device previously turned heads at MWC, Cannes, and the Shanghai Film Festival.
The Robot Phone features a built-in motorized 3-axis mechanical gimbal. This titanium mechanical arm tracks subjects and executes cinematic shots autonomously. It can also react to its surroundings and hold real, natural conversations.

However, physical AI scaling is facing major friction. Uber recently blindsided Serve Robotics. The ride-sharing giant sold its entire stake in the delivery robot startup.
Serve was spun out of Postmates after Uber’s $2.65 billion acquisition in 2020. Serve only learned of the exit through public regulatory disclosures.
The sudden split reveals diverging views on how to scale autonomous delivery fleets. This friction is a valuable lesson.

The Suitcase Supply Chain: Surviving Geopolitical Friction
Building physical AI hardware is getting harder. US robotics startups are reportedly facing severe supply chain gaps. Development is moving faster than domestic manufacturing can support.
To solve this, engineers are making personal shopping trips to Shenzhen. According to a report by The Information, they are carrying robot parts back in their luggage.
They buy specialized components in the Huaqiangbei electronics market. Then, they hand-carry them back to the US to bypass shipment delays.
This “suitcase supply chain” highlights a glaring irony. Washington banned new Chinese robot imports last month. Yet, America’s robotics industry still relies heavily on Chinese hardware.
